The Singaporeans has not been largely affected by the huge spike of food prices in the country. They may rest assured as the suppliers are not going to take the advantage of them by raising the cost of food items further.
The Minister of State for Trade and Industry, Lee Yi Shyan has introduced the Retail Price Watch Group (RPWG). This has been launched on Friday. The Retail Price Watch Group will keep its eye on the prices of the food items. It will also take action against the suppliers who will raise prices haphazardly to trouble the consumers.
The minister has also indicted that the group of 13 will have a meet at least once in every month. They will have a review of the Consumer Price Index (CPI) for food.
They will monitor the frequently chaining price pressure and also look after any of the hike in this system. It will also organize educational campaigns for the consumers to make the public know all about the mitigate prices hikes.
